Quantum Tech Shocker: IonQ Seals Multi-Million Dollar Deal for LightSynq, Igniting Quantum Internet Race
IonQ turbocharges its quantum ambitions, completing the $492M LightSynq takeover with 12.3M shares and a tech arsenal for 2025.
- Deal Size: 12,377,433 shares valued at $492.7 million
- Patents: 20 exclusive patents and patent applications
- Purpose: Photonic interconnects & quantum memory
- Completion Date: June 3, 2025
IonQ, a pioneer in quantum computing, has just shocked the industry by completing its high-stakes acquisition of Boston-based LightSynq Technologies. The deal—now valued at a staggering $492.7 million—transfers over 12.3 million IonQ shares into LightSynq’s hands, securing a quantum edge for years to come.
This power move comes as the demand for robust quantum networks surges around the globe. LightSynq, a leader in photonic interconnects and advanced quantum memory, brings not just technology but intellectual property—20 patents and applications—that could accelerate the race towards a functional quantum internet.
The bold acquisition was first hinted in IonQ’s recent quarterly report, but now the ink is dry and the future of connected quantum computers has never looked brighter.
Q: Why Did IonQ Snap Up LightSynq Now?
IonQ’s main goal is clear: dominate the landscape of quantum networking. As companies chase the holy grail of the quantum internet, connecting quantum processors is critical. LightSynq’s specialty in photonic interconnects plugs a crucial gap—allowing IonQ to cluster multiple quantum computers, boosting their collective power and potential.
Q: What Are Photonic Interconnects and Why Do They Matter?
Photonic interconnects use light particles to transmit quantum information between processors at blistering speeds. This is far faster and more reliable than conventional electronic links. With quantum memory added to the mix, IonQ could store and transfer quantum data seamlessly, inching closer to Microsoft and Google in the race toward next-generation computing.
